Espace de noms Microsoft.ComplexEventProcessing.Extensibility
Dans cet article
Expose les API utilisées pour les agrégats et les opérateurs définis par l'utilisateur. Pour plus d'informations, consultez Agrégats et opérateurs définis par l'utilisateur .
Classes
CepAggregate< (Of < ( <'TInput, TOutput> ) > ) >
Classe de base pour un agrégat non limité dans le temps, non incrémentiel et défini par l'utilisateur.
CepEdgeStreamOperator< (Of < ( <'TInputPayload, TOutputPayload> ) > ) >
Crée un opérateur de flux de données défini par l'utilisateur qui traite les événements session dans l'ordre de synchronisation.
CepModule< (Of < ( <'TInput, TOutput> ) > ) >
Classe de base pour un opérateur ou agrégat non limité dans le temps, non incrémentiel et défini par l'utilisateur.
CepOperator< (Of < ( <'TInput, TOutput> ) > ) >
Classe de base pour un opérateur non limité dans le temps, non incrémentiel et défini par l'utilisateur.
CepPointStreamOperator< (Of < ( <'TInputPayload, TOutputPayload> ) > ) >
Crée un opérateur de flux de données défini par l'utilisateur qui traite les événements point dans l'ordre StartTime.
CepStreamOperator
Crée un opérateur de flux de données défini par l'utilisateur qui traite les événements dans l'ordre de synchronisation.
CepStreamOperator< (Of < ( <'TInputEvent, TInputPayload, TOutputPayload> ) > ) >
Crée un opérateur de flux de données défini par l'utilisateur qui traite les événements dans l'ordre de synchronisation.
CepTimeSensitiveAggregate< (Of < ( <'TInput, TOutput> ) > ) >
Classe de base pour un agrégat limité dans le temps, non incrémentiel et défini par l'utilisateur.
CepTimeSensitiveModule< (Of < ( <'TInput, TOutput> ) > ) >
Classe de base pour un opérateur ou agrégat limité dans le temps, non incrémentiel et défini par l'utilisateur.
CepTimeSensitiveOperator< (Of < ( <'TInput, TOutput> ) > ) >
Classe de base pour un opérateur limité dans le temps, non incrémentiel et défini par l'utilisateur.
Structures
WindowDescriptor
Le descripteur de fenêtre fournit des informations sur les propriétés temporelles de la fenêtre qui contient les événements entrés dans un opérateur ou un agrégat limité dans le temps et défini par l'utilisateur.
Interfaces
IDeclareEventProperties
Définit des propriétés pour les opérateurs ou agrégats définis par l'utilisateur pour fournir des informations supplémentaires sur le champ d'événement, telles que les informations de culture pour un champ de chaîne dans le résultat.